Transaction

8e4b3aef2786333b28eb1864aa476cffa5cd93d44c61d25aee9580c64e2d0c44

Summary

In Block376172
TimeFri, 29 Sep 2023 02:33:30 UTC
Total Input2465.35040711 Nebula
Total Output2499.35040711 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
589950 Confirmations2499.35040711 Nebula
Raw Transaction